{"product_id":"johnny-cash-american-recordings","title":"Johnny Cash - American Recordings","description":"\u003cp dir=\"ltr\"\u003eIn 1993 Johnny Cash was a legend without a label, dropped by Nashville and playing dinner theaters. Rick Rubin signed him, sat him in a living room with a guitar, and let him sing whatever he wanted. The American Recordings series that followed became the greatest late-career resurrection in popular music.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p dir=\"ltr\"\u003eThis is where it started, in 1994: just Cash and an acoustic guitar, recorded mostly in Rubin's living room and at Cash's cabin. \"Delia's Gone\" opens with a murder ballad delivered flat and cold, Nick Lowe's \"The Beast in Me\" and Tom Waits's \"Down There by the Train\" reveal themselves as Cash songs all along, and Glenn Danzig wrote \"Thirteen\" specially for him.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p dir=\"ltr\"\u003eIt won a Grammy for Best Contemporary Folk Album and reintroduced Cash to an audience that had never bought a country record in its life.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p dir=\"ltr\"\u003ePressed on 180-gram vinyl with a download card.
